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Steamworks flat interface overhaul #33

Open
zpostfacto opened this issue Feb 22, 2020 · 1 comment
Open

Steamworks flat interface overhaul #33

zpostfacto opened this issue Feb 22, 2020 · 1 comment
Labels
enhancement Stuff related to new and shiny things

Comments

@zpostfacto
Copy link

Hey Gramps!

I've just updated the Steamworks SDK. Version 1.48 includes a pretty big overhaul to the flat interface, and a new windows-event-like manual callback dispatch mechanism. The goal is to make binding layers like this easier to write. Less manual maintenance, and less gross hackery under the hood.

When you get a sec, please take a look at it, and if you have any questions or complaints, email me.

@Gramps
Copy link
Collaborator

Gramps commented Feb 22, 2020

Hey Fletcher,

That's awesome! I was just in the Steamworks site today and didn't see the 1.48 update but just logged in and there it is!

An overhaul to the flat interface is very exciting as is the new callback dispatch. I will dig into this all over the weekend. Glad to hear this is going to make everything easier.

Thank you so much for the update and I'll definitely let you know if I have any questions or such! Cheers!

@Gramps Gramps added the enhancement Stuff related to new and shiny things label Feb 22,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ement Stuff related to new and shiny things
Projects
None yet
Development

No branches or pull requests

2 participants